I have stayed at Namale, Vatulele & Turtle in Fiji and a semi-overwater bungalow at the Aitutaki Lagoon resort (didn't Pearl beach own them for awhile?) and Pacific resort but on Raro. The one on Aitutaki was just being built them. Hmmm, for a honeymoon, Namale is heavenly BUT the beach is not the best. My favorite was Vatulele for unbelievably friendly people, superb food, service, seclusion, beach, snokeling. Aitutaki lagoon is fantastic but the weather is more iffy there, more southernly. No pool at Vatulele though...but with your own stretch of beach, who needs it! It's hard to give advise, everyone is different but if you decide on Pacific Resort, let us know how it goes!

Peggy - The place was originally called the Aitutaki Lagoon Resort. It was sold to Pearl Beach Resorts in 2001 or so, then a year or so ago it was sold to the folks that own the Rarotongan Resort on Rarotonga and reverted back to the name of "Aitutaki Lagoon Resort".

So yes, it used to be a Pearl Beach.
